What Does a Business Insurance Agent in Santee Cost?

Typical costs for a small business insurance package in California range from 500 to 3000 dollars per year for general liability. Workers compensation premiums vary by payroll and industry classification often costing 1 to 5 dollars per 100 dollars of payroll. Commercial property insurance may add 500 to 2000 dollars annually. Actual costs depend on your specific business operations location and claims history. This is general information and does not constitute insurance advice.

Frequently Asked Questions

What types of business insurance do Santee agents offer?
Agents in Santee offer general liability commercial property workers compensation and commercial auto insurance. They also provide professional liability and cyber liability policies. Coverage options depend on your industry and business size.
Does California require business insurance for all companies?
California law requires workers compensation insurance for any business with at least one employee. Commercial auto insurance is required for vehicles used for business. General liability is not mandated by state law but is often required by landlords or clients.
